On Tuesday, ESPN’s Shams Charania reported what is currently the most concrete NBA Draft reform — designed by the league to combat tanking, which has been a major subject of discussion in 2025-26 season. The NBA has disclosed to its 30 GMs a singular new anti-tanking reform that expands the draft lottery to 16 teams, flattens odds, and have a relegation zone where the bottom 3 teams are penalized with fewer lottery balls for the No. 1 pick.
